1<?php 2 3use Fisharebest\Webtrees\Tree; 4use Illuminate\Support\Collection; 5 6/** 7 * @var Collection<int,string> $main_blocks 8 * @var Collection<int,string> $side_blocks 9 * @var string $title 10 * @var Tree $tree 11 */ 12 13?> 14<h2 class="text-center"> 15 <?= $title ?> 16</h2> 17 18<div class="row"> 19 <?php if ($main_blocks->isEmpty() || $side_blocks->isEmpty()) : ?> 20 <div class="col-md-12 wt-main-blocks"> 21 <?php foreach ($main_blocks->concat($side_blocks) as $block_id => $block) : ?> 22 <?= view('user-page-block', ['block_id' => $block_id, 'block' => $block, 'tree' => $tree]) ?> 23 <?php endforeach ?> 24 </div> 25 <?php else : ?> 26 <div class="col-md-8 wt-main-blocks"> 27 <?php foreach ($main_blocks as $block_id => $block) : ?> 28 <?= view('user-page-block', ['block_id' => $block_id, 'block' => $block, 'tree' => $tree]) ?> 29 <?php endforeach ?> 30 </div> 31 <div class="col-md-4 wt-side-blocks"> 32 <?php foreach ($side_blocks as $block_id => $block) : ?> 33 <?= view('user-page-block', ['block_id' => $block_id, 'block' => $block, 'tree' => $tree]) ?> 34 <?php endforeach ?> 35 </div> 36 <?php endif ?> 37</div> 38